The sloka is-

Vane-vane nivasanto vrikshah. Vanam-vanam rachayanti vrikshah.

Shakhadolaseena vihagaha Taih kimapi koojanti vrikshah.

Pibanti pavanam jalam santatam sadhujana iv sarve vrikshah.

sprishanti padaiha patalam cha nabhah shirassu vahanti vrikshah.

Payodarpane swapratibimbam kautuken pashyanti vrikshah.

prasarya swacchayasanstaranam kurvanti satkaram vrikshah.

Vane-vane nivasanto vrikshah. Vanam-vanam rachayanti vrikshah.

Meaning-

Trees live in forests and forests are made because of trees.Thinking of branches as swings, many birds sit on trees and chirp. Trees drink only air and water, which make them like saints. They touch the hell with their feet and carry the sky on their heads. With surprise they see their reflections in the mirror like water. They give respect to the travellers passing by, by spreading their bed in the form of shadow
